An admirably compact guide, featuring small illustrations of 1,250 species, brief descriptions and black-and-white range maps. A "Princeton Illustrated Checklist," this compact book is especially appealing for the advanced birder who doesn't require more extensive descriptions.

A collection of 19 mostly classic traveler's accounts of South Africa. It is a vivid introduction to the land by foreign luminaries and comic masters, including Mark Twain, Alan Moorhead, Michael Palin and P.J. O'Rourke. Not surprisingly Cape Town, Johannesburg and Durban feature prominently. Organized chronologically, it provides insight into how foreigners have responded to the country, its culture and racial politics from 1850 to 1997.
